Well here is what you all have been waiting for!

Here are the before pics!! Lots of Junk around isnt there!!!


This is my daughters doll house. I got it free when a kid in my class used it for a project two years ago. Its a fixer upper but has 3 stories!!


Here is a shot of the chip storage area next to the fridge. Many of my chips are stored in the TASK FORCE case. Most are in chip boxes.


Here are the after shots! No more junk now!!!

This is from the open garage door.


Wall decorum. This hangs up all the time, showing my dedication to the GPT!! Those signs are hand painted.


Close up of the Dogs Playing Poker Rug, which my parents bought and hung on thier living room wall when I was a baby! (That makes it 32 years old!!!)

These are tables. No really I know that you know that.

I have had 3 tables set up at a time, and one time I even had 4 tables in here. It was majorly cramped though. Majorly!!! Usually there are between 15 and 18 guys. The largest tournament was the GPT Invitational, and I had 25 at three tables. But for the that event I opened the garage door and set up a large tent that was closed in on 3 sides. We set up two tables for cash games while the tournament was finishing up.


Woodstove allows for great games to be held year round!! Old man winter has nothing on me!!


Tournament Rules. Always posted so there's no bitchin!!


Cash Set. Sopranos. They may be cheap chips but the guys love 'em!!


Tournanment Set. Faux Clays. Again they may be cheap chips but they really get the job done. These are also gonna look outstanding once I get my labels in the Spring! The purple, yellow, and grey will be used with my plaques as a large denom T175K tournament.


This is the entertainment area. Extremely high tech old school TV with, yes that's right a VCR. Plus the mandatory tapes of WPT, WSOP, and Poker Royale shows!!


Well thanks for taking a peek at the official home of the GARAGE POKER TOUR !!!!!!!

My humble entry. It a refinshed basement, added the wood stove, built walls and the closets, added a window, put down the cork floor (yes cork - and actually ever so slightly springy), suspended ceiling, all electrical. Still have some trim work and painiting to do. I built the table top to sit on an existing table, just 4x4 square with a fixed woodedn edge - maybe got $15 into it.
Just picked up the foosball table used - for $75. Covered poker table. Sleeper couch. Dart board. TV. Last pic is dog - see why I love those Lab Paulsons? Thanks for looking!
